Re: Project#1: Bright Horizons - 68 Swb on Air
Progress today. Got the rad support and fenders loose...ready to pull front clip tomorrow. Got the a/c box loose ready to remove once fenders are off (hood hinge is in the way of course) and removed the power brakes and the rest of the wiring and vacuum lines/heater hoses. Would have gotten more done but time was spent moving the truck to pull the engine then moving it back when the guy cancelled. Also had to find bolts and the chains for lifting the block out (at the shop so I don't know where the stuff is and I'm HORRIBLE at finding things if I didn't put them away - just ask my wife
